The Reebok Work RB045 Women's Sublite Cushion Work Alloy Safety Toe is an exceptional choice for those seeking a perfect blend of style, comfort, and safety in their work footwear. Engineered to provide maximum lightness and flexibility, these athletic oxford shoes feature deep flex grooves that allow for a greater range of motion, making them ideal for the demanding environments you may encounter at work.
One standout feature is the Sublite foam midsole, which not only reduces overall weight but also provides soft support and cushioning throughout your day. The rubber pads strategically positioned on the sole enhance traction during heel strikes and forefoot takeoff, promoting stability without adding unnecessary bulk.
The breathable mesh uppers ensure excellent moisture transfer, keeping your feet cool and comfortable even during extended hours on the job. Coupled with a MemoryTech Massage footbed, this shoe adapts perfectly to the contours of your feet, delivering immediate cushioning relief.

When it comes to comfort, the Reebok Work RB045 excels with its thoughtfully designed elements. The lightweight construction significantly reduces fatigue, especially for those who spend long hours on their feet. The low-cut design not only provides ease of movement but also enhances an athletic aesthetic that fits well in various workplace environments.
The memory foam footbed ensures that each stride is cushioned, catering to the unique shape of your foot. This feature is particularly beneficial if you're working in roles that require prolonged standing or walking.
In terms of safety, these shoes meet ASTM F2413 standards, ensuring adequate protection against workplace hazards. The alloy toe cap delivers impact resistance while maintaining a lighter profile than traditional steel toe caps.
However, potential buyers should consider that while the fit is generally true to size, some users have reported that the shoe may be slightly narrow, particularly for those with wider feet. Additionally, arch support could be somewhat lacking for individuals who require more assistance in that area.
